Hua Eng Wire & Cable has been growing earnings at an average annual rate of 28.1%, while the Electrical industry saw earnings growing at 16.9% annually. Revenues have been growing at an average rate of 7.2% per year. Hua Eng Wire & Cable's return on equity is 10.8%, and it has net margins of 9.7%.

Quality Earnings: 1608 has a large one-off gain of NT$392.8M impacting its last 12 months of financial results to 31st December, 2023.
Growing Profit Margin: 1608 became profitable in the past.
Free Cash Flow vs Earnings Analysis
Past Earnings Growth Analysis
Earnings Trend: 1608 has become profitable over the past 5 years, growing earnings by 28.1% per year.
Accelerating Growth: 1608 has become profitable in the last year, making the earnings growth rate difficult to compare to its 5-year average.
Earnings vs Industry: 1608 has become profitable in the last year, making it difficult to compare its past year earnings growth to the Electrical industry (-27%).
Return on Equity
High ROE: 1608's Return on Equity (10.8%) is considered low.
